Combination microwave ovens combine the speed of microwave cooking with the crisping and browning abilities of conventional ovens to offer an efficient kitchen appliance. Imagine a meat pie for the family: Microwaves swiftly heat the filling while hot air bakes and crisps the pastry to perfection, giving you the filling being hot and piping hot, wrapped in a crispy pastry that cooks up to 40% quicker than baking in an oven that is traditional.

While AHAM and Whirlpool claim that DOE's current class structure is overly restrictive, DOE's engineering analysis shows that existing microwave ovens with the full complement of consumer features are at or close to the maximum efficiency level. DOE's analysis also includes shipment-weighted average standby power consumption information, which demonstrates that the elements of the design of the chassis as well as installation configuration (i.e. countertop, over the range and built-in) have a greater impact on the power consumption of these microwaves than the presence or absence of convection functions.

Microwaves come in different sizes and power levels to suit an array of cooking requirements. Smaller models are great for quick reheats or frozen meals. Larger models can accommodate large meals and leftovers. Some models can also be used to bake, steam and roasting.
Apart from the power and size as well as power, you'll need to think about your kitchen layout and the frequency you cook to determine which model is the best one for your home. If you plan to use your microwave primarily for heating or defrosting foods and food items, then a standard model with a circular turntable will be a good fit. If you are looking to try new recipes and increase your culinary abilities using a convection cooker, it could be the better choice.
Certain models of microwaves come with adjustable racks that let you to stack bowls or plates for multi-dish cooking. Some models have a turntable that rotates for an even and efficient food placement.
